What is being bought
Somerset Council (SC) is seeking a strategic delivery partner to develop and deliver Somerset’s core tailored learning programme. SC would like to work flexibly with the successful contractor to ensure the programme is agile and can be reviewed and re-shaped to meet evolving need.
